Add *Markdown Cells* when you want to comment a section or subsection.\n\nSubmit the lab when you're done.\n\n## Coding The Hard Way\n\nZed A. Shaw is a popular author of several books where he\ndescribes learning a programming language The Hard Way.\nZed suggests, and we at Zip Code agree with him wholeheartedly, that the best, most impactful, highest return for\nyour investment when learning to code, is _type the code\nusing your own fingers_.\n\nThat’s right. Whether you are a \"visual learner\", a \"video\nlearner\", or someone who can read textbooks like novels\n(are there any more of these out there?), the best way to\nlearn to code is to code and to code by typing out the code\nwith your own fingers. This means you DO NOT do a lot of\ncopy and paste of code blocks; you really put in the work,\nmaking your brain better wired to code by coding with\nyour own typing of the code.\n","funding_links":[],"categories":[],"sub_categories":[],"project_url":"https://awesome.ecosyste.ms/api/v1/projects/github.com%2Fzipcodecore%2Fwesch4-numpy","html_url":"https://awesome.ecosyste.ms/projects/github.com%2Fzipcodecore%2Fwesch4-numpy","lists_url":"https://awesome.ecosyste.ms/api/v1/projects/github.com%2Fzipcodecore%2Fwesch4-numpy/lists"}
